What is an Infrared COB LED?

An infrared COB LED, or Chip-on-Board LED, is a type of light source that integrates multiple tiny LED chips onto a single substrate. This compact design allows for a high density of light-emitting diodes, resulting in superior performance and energy efficiency. Unlike traditional LED packages, the COB LED eliminates the need for packaging materials, which not only reduces costs but also enhances the overall reliability of the product.
